Abstract

A hybrid blast furnace simulator has been developed on the basis of mathematical model and experiments by combining differential fixed-bed reactor and micro computers. Assuming that the burden and gas phase moved counter-currently in the blast furnace, the experimental conditions were calculated in real time by putting in situ measured rates of reduction and solution loss to the differential equations of mass and heat balance, and the new experimental conditions were set at next stage. The simulation was performed by repeating the sequence.
(1) If simulation conditions were set up so as to fit the burdens, the simulation successfully proceeded and the longitudinal distribution of process variables in B.F. could be expected precisely according to the reactivity of burdens.
(2) When the operations with pellet and sinter were simulated, thermal reserve zone was longer and smelting reduction began at lower temperatures for the former than for the latter.
(3) With lower coke rate, reduction hardly proceeded and burden was heated up during short descending. On the other hand, with higher coke rate, although reduction proceeded fast, burdens remained at low temperatures.
